搜索到与相关的文章
操作系统

LSPCI具体解释分析

一、PCI简单介绍PCI是一种外设总线规范。我们先来看一下什么是总线:总线是一种传输信号的路径或信道。典型情况是,总线是连接于一个或多个导体的电气连线,总线上连接的全部设备可在同一时间收到全部的传输内容。总线由电气接口和编程接口组成。本文讨论Linux下的设备驱动,所以,重点关注编程接口。PCI是PeripheralComponentInterconnect(外围设备互联)的简称,是普遍使用在桌面及更大型的计算机上的外设总线。PCI架构被设计为ISA标准的

系统 2019-08-12 01:32:28 2531

Python

python3使用Tornado的搭建HTTPS服务

前言最近需要使用https搭建一个api故简单记录一下搭建过程搭建http的服务简单快捷,这里就不做其他介绍有关https的原理请参考图解HTTPS环境搭建(非必须)这个环境其实不是必须的,我再搭建的时候,并没有安装这个环境,因为我的linux服务器自带的有了,可能是在安装其他软件的时候再带安装上去了,所以可以自我检测一下。一、安装OpenSSLOpenSSL介绍OpenSSL是一个强大的安全套接字层密码库,囊括主要的密码算法、常用的密钥和证书封装管理功能

系统 2019-09-27 17:57:00 2530

Python

Python C扩展实践&性能对比

C扩展实践因为性能等一些原因,希望用C来扩展python。有多种方法,例如:ctypes调用socythonpython接口的C函数这里阐述最后一种方式的实现。首先需要#include需要实现下面三个函数:staticPyObject*funcName(PyObject*self,PyObject*args)/*函数定义*/staticPyMethodDefmethodsList[]/*方法映射*/PyMODINIT_FUNCinitModule()/*M

系统 2019-09-27 17:53:04 2530

Python

python学习——爬虫(抖音)

爬虫仅限于知识学习,本代码不得用于任何商业活动侵权,如有不适,请联系博主进行修改或者删除。今天总结的第三篇,这些个代码是模仿着写出来的,这儿我着重写我觉有用的东西了,一上午过去了,还只弄完三篇,时间好紧张啊。访问的是https://www.douyin.com/share/user/63692754272的抖音,找到其url,并进行访问首先摆出源码importrequestsimportjsonurl="https://www.douyin.com/web

系统 2019-09-27 17:52:55 2530

Python

Python中字符串string模块

一、string模块常用函数ascii_letters获取所有ascii码中字母字符的字符串(包含大写和小写)ascii_uppercase获取所有ascii码中的大写英文字母ascii_lowercase获取所有ascii码中的小写英文字母digits获取所有的10进制数字字符octdigits获取所有的8进制数字字符hexdigits获取所有16进制的数字字符printable获取所有可以打印的字符whitespace获取所有空白字符punctuati

系统 2019-09-27 17:51:11 2530

Linux

Linux syslog日志服务器架设攻略

作者:华江从目前的情况来看,Syslog(系统日志)这一历史悠久的日志系统仍旧占据着最主流的地位。由于与类UNIX平台之间的渊源,Syslog是在实际应用环境中最容易获得的日志系统。同时,还有很多的基于Syslog的扩展产品存在,这其中也包括大量基于UNIX平台构建内核的网络硬件设备,这些设备往往都内置了Syslog功能支持,例如Cisco路由器就是如此。一、配置syslog守护进程syslog是Linux系统默认的日志守护进程。默认的syslog配置文件

系统 2019-08-29 23:40:03 2530

编程技术

Cocos2d开发系列(一)

Cocos2d是一个比较流行的iphone游戏开发框架,据说在AppStore上已有超过100个游戏是基亍Cocos2D-iPhone。其中3个由此迚入过TOP10的排名。其中的StickWars更是曾排名第一。现在,让我们来开始Cocos2d的学习之旅吧!一、安装下载Cocos2d下载地址:http://code.google.com/p/cocos2d-iphone/downloads/list当前最新版本为1.0。本教程选用的是稳定版本0.99.5。

系统 2019-08-29 23:29:03 2530

编程技术

New Book:锋利的SQL

从2009年初开始动笔到最终定稿,这本书的编写花费了我一年多的时间,大大超出了先前预期的计划。当时,书刚刚开了个头,我便被安排参加了单位的一个流程优化项目,其中包含5个新系统的开发和1个旧系统的改造。同时,我自己还主持着一个管理信息系统的开发工作。项目目标定义、业务需求分析、系统架构设计,环环相扣,整天忙的不可开交,写作成了真正忙里偷闲的事。当系统一个个瓜熟蒂落,能够自己支配的时间才稍微充裕了一些,这本书的写作才算步入正轨。好在我写作只是自己的一种业余爱好

系统 2019-08-29 23:08:59 2530

编程技术

Magento数据库结构:EAV

Magento的表有三百多张,以实体、属性、值(EAV)的数据库结构难以掌握,加上缺少有关EAV的文档,以至许多人不知道这种EAV方式的好处以及它对magento来说的重要性,在这里作为一名magento开发者,让我们来了解下,它是如何工作的并且对我们有什么好处。什么是EAV呢?EAV是实体(Entity)、属性(Attribute)、值(Value)的意思,接下来来看看每一部分以便更好的理解它。实体(Entity)实体指的是magento的数据对象,如产

系统 2019-08-29 22:41:34 2530

编程技术

最近的一些感想

最近一个朋友想我推荐鲜血梅花这本小说。大意:冥冥之中,有一条路就是你要走的正确道路。可能你会受到各种干扰,会犯错,但没关系,错了你就回来。这才想起已经很久没有读小说了。大脑中满满的塞着各种语言的代码片断,以至于思维也不那么细腻了。通过搜索引擎顺藤摸瓜找到了:爱莲书屋,一个让我记忆深刻的网址。每天都是24小时,让生活更丰富点吧,我想腾出点时间看点文学作品。最近还发现自己有个坏习惯:喜欢阅读各种程序的代码,不求甚解的那种

系统 2019-08-29 22:36:28 2530